Zimbabwe: Mugabe Stays Away From Regional Summit

11 April 2008

President Robert Mugabe of Zimbabwe will not attend Saturday's extraordinary summit of the Southern African Development Community, called to discuss his country's election crisis.

This was first reported by ZBC News, Zimbabwe's government-controlled broadcaster. It quoted the permanent secretary in the Zimbabwe foreign ministry, Joey Bimha, as saying the summit was "unnecessary."

Three cabinet ministers would represent the country, ZBC News said. The meeting will be held in Zambia.
